Start with your exact iPhone model
The frozen product option in this guide lists iPhone 14 Plus Case. It does not establish compatibility with iPhone 14, iPhone 14 Pro, iPhone 14 Pro Max, or another model. Because those names are similar, verify the complete device name before spending time comparing illustrations.
A quick model-check workflow
- Open Settings > General > About on your iPhone.
- Read the full model name, including “Plus” when shown.
- Open the product page and confirm that the current selector includes that exact model.
- Select each candidate pattern and review its current image.
- Check current price, availability, and other purchase details on the live page.
If you need help confirming the device, consult Apple’s official iPhone identification reference. This article does not claim cross-model fit, protection, material, or charging behavior.

How can I confirm my iPhone model?
Go to Settings, General, and About, then read the complete model name. Apple’s identification guide provides additional model details.
